1 lira 1942
A total of 274.050 units were minted at the Roma mint. It is made of Stainless steel. It weighs 8,00 g and has a diameter of 26,70 mm. Its rarity is catalogued as very scarce. An important note for this coin is “Pio XII”.
It corresponds to the first issue of this coin.
